RETRACTABLE UMBRELLA FRAME DEVICE
20220133004 · 2022-05-05 ·

Disclosed herein are retractable umbrella frame devices comprising a base body structure at least partially surrounding a central axis structure. The central axis structure can be connected to a skeletal frame structure comprising a plurality of arms having a first end connected to the central axis structure and a second free end. The plurality of arms can be moveably connected to the central axis structure, such that the arms can be retracted into or extended from the base body structure. In some embodiments, the base body structure comprises open portions along its length. In some embodiments, the retractable umbrella frame devices further comprise one or more secondary support structures at least partially surrounding the base body structure. In some embodiments, the retractable umbrella frame devices can further comprise guide structures connected to the one or more secondary support structures and the arms of the skeletal frame structure.

PORTABLE SHELTERS
20220136276 · 2022-05-05 ·

A portable shelter includes a frame structure with a plurality of pole structures. In some embodiments, a pole structure includes telescopically movable pole portions and a spring-biasing mechanism configured to bias one pole portion away from the other. In some embodiments, a center hub structure of the portable shelter includes a locking mechanism for engaging one of the pole portions to interfere with telescopic movement of the pole structure. In some embodiments, a pole structure includes a flexible portion attached to a first rigid portion, and a second rigid portion that is movable relative to the first rigid portion. The second rigid portion is pivotable or telescopically movable between a first position in which the second rigid portion overlaps the first rigid portion such that the flexible portion is free to flex, and a second position in which the second rigid portion overlaps and restrains the flexible portion.

Locking system for the rotating foot of a mast, particularly for a free arm standing parasol
11723445 · 2023-08-15 · ·

In a locking system for a rotating foot of a mast, particularly of a mast for a free arm standing parasol, the mast is rotatable about an axis of rotation (A) defined by the rotating foot and includes a surrounded mast region. The locking system includes an operating lever for releasing or locking of the rotating foot which is arranged on the mast at a comfort height (H) of 0.5 to 1.5 m above the rotating foot, wherein the operating lever is movable between a folded-out position and a downwardly folded-in position and thereby cooperates via a lifting bar with stationary engaging elements of the rotating foot, wherein the lifting bar is raised in the release position and lowered in the locking position. To improve operability and operational security, the lifting bar is arranged at a distance from the axis of rotation (A) and externally of the surrounded mast region.

Straight-pole sun umbrella hand-cranking device

A straight-pole sun umbrella hand-cranking device comprises a standing pole and a shell fixed on the standing pole, wherein the shell comprises a first outer shell and a second outer shell. The shell is fixed on one side of the standing pole, and a rope winding wheel is mounted within the first and the second outer shells. The rope winding wheel is connected to a cranking shaft, and the cranking shaft is propelled to rotate through a cranking handle connected with the cranking shaft. An anti-slip mechanism is arranged on the cranking shaft. The anti-slip mechanism comprises a torsion spring, the torsion spring is sleeved on the cranking shaft. The rope winding wheel achieves easy winding or unwinding of the ropes, and the anti-slip performance is improved by the elastic force of the spring. As the aforesaid structure is protected against abrasion, its functional life is significantly prolonged.

Outdoor umbrella capable of being folded and unfolded by pressing

An outdoor umbrella includes an umbrella post, an umbrella cover assembly and a folding-unfolding device. The umbrella cover assembly includes an umbrella rib assembly and an umbrella fabric covering the umbrella rib assembly. The folding-unfolding device includes a slide sleeve, a folding-unfolding handle assembly and a pull rod. A first oblique rod and a second oblique rod hinged and matched with each other are disposed on the umbrella rib assembly. One end of the first oblique rod is hinged to the slide sleeve. One end of the second oblique rod is hinged and matched with the umbrella post. A middle portion of the folding-unfolding handle assembly is hinged and matched with the umbrella post, and the folding-unfolding handle assembly is able to vertically stretch the pull rod in cooperation with a lever and drives the slide sleeve to slide vertically to fold or unfold the umbrella cover assembly.

Electronic umbrella
11317687 · 2022-05-03 ·

An electronic umbrella is provided. The device includes a housing having a fastener disposed on a lower surface thereof. A motor is disposed within the housing, wherein the motor is operably connected to a power source disposed within the housing. A rod is affixed to an upper surface of the housing. An extendable arm is affixed to the rod, wherein the extendable arm is operably connected to the motor. Upon actuation of the motor, the extendable arm moves between an extended position and a retracted position. The device further includes an umbrella assembly having a central support, a plurality of ribs extending from the central support, and a canopy affixed over the plurality of ribs. The central support is pivotally affixed to a distal end of the extendable arm.
